Sustainable Waterproof Products for Outdoor Camping: What Every Eco-Conscious Traveler Should Know
The outdoors calls to those who love it-- however loving it indicates shielding it. For several years, the outdoor camping industry has actually depended on waterproofing technologies that include a major ecological expense: PFAS (per- and polyfluoroalkyl materials), likewise known as "permanently chemicals," have been the foundation of most waterproof fabrics. These chemicals do not break down in the setting or in the human body, and their effects are only starting to be understood. The bright side? Sustainable choices are arriving, and they are truly outstanding.
Why Typical Waterproofing Is a Problem
The majority of water-proof camping equipment-- tents, rain coats, backpack covers, resting bag shells-- counts on sturdy water repellent (DWR) finishings or laminated membrane layers. The standard DWR formulas are fluorine-based, which implies they lost water remarkably yet linger in ecological communities, waterways, and bodies forever. Even when you wash your coat, microscopic bits of these chemicals rinse and travel downstream. For an area of individuals who truly love rivers, woodlands, and hills, this is a hard truth to sit with.
Past DWR coverings, synthetic membrane layers like ePTFE (expanded polytetrafluoroethylene, the material behind Gore-Tex) are stemmed from petroleum and are hard to reuse. Their manufacturing is energy-intensive, and their end-of-life tale is primarily garbage dump.
Emerging Lasting Alternatives
Plant-Based and Bio-Derived Waterproofing
A number of brand names are now buying bio-based DWR treatments originated from plant oils, starches, and waxes. These layers reproduce the hydrophobic impact of fluorine-based treatments without the persistence. Brands like Nikwax and Grangers have led this fee for several years with fluorine-free wash-in therapies, while fabric producers are progressively using plant-derived finishes at the factory level. Performance is not yet similar to PFAS-based layers in severe problems, but for most three-season camping, they stand up well.
Waxed and Oiled Natural Fabrics
Standard waxed canvas has actually made a solid resurgence-- and for good reason. Firmly woven cotton treated with paraffin or plant-based wax develops a breathable, sturdy, and fully biodegradable water resistant obstacle. While larger than synthetic options, waxed canvas camping tents and packs create a beautiful patina, can be re-waxed indefinitely, and produce no microplastics when worn or washed. Brands like Filson and smaller boutique camping tent makers are bringing this century-old innovation right into contemporary camping applications.
Recycled Artificial Membrane Layers
For those who still desire the integrity of a synthetic membrane layer, recycled options are becoming mainstream. Fabrics yert tent made from recycled family pet (plastic bottles) and ocean-recovered nylon currently bring fluorine-free membrane layers from suppliers like Toray and Sympatex. These materials are not excellent-- recycled synthetics still shed microplastics-- yet they stand for a meaningful step down in virgin source intake and carbon footprint.
All-natural Rubber and Silicone Coatings
Silicone-impregnated nylon (silnylon) and silicone-polyester blends are progressively popular for ultralight tarpaulins and sanctuaries. Silicone itself is much more chemically stable and much less hazardous than PFAS, and it bonds deeply right into textile fibres as opposed to sitting on the surface, making it more durable in time. In a similar way, natural rubber-coated fabrics use a totally biodegradable waterproofing choice, generally used in heavy-duty rainfall covers and groundsheets.
What to Seek When Buying
Navigating greenwashing in the outside sector can really feel challenging. Below are a few markers of truly sustainable waterproof equipment to try to find when you store.
Accreditations issue. Seek bluesign-approved fabrics, which ensure accountable production from resource to rack. OEKO-TEX certification signals that the end product is devoid of unsafe chemical residues. Both are meaningful third-party standards rather than advertising language.
Inspect the DWR chemistry. Brands significantly divulge whether their DWR is C0 (entirely fluorine-free), C6, or C8-- C8 is one of the most harmful and has actually been widely eliminated, while C0 is the cleanest option.
Prioritise repairability and long life. One of the most sustainable piece of equipment is the one you utilize for fifteen years. Brand names supplying life time repair programmes, replacement parts, and clear care overviews are signalling that their items are constructed to last-- which inevitably matters greater than the chemistry of any kind of solitary finish.
